Mamaw's Swiss Steak Recipe

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
1 1/2-2 inch thick Round or Chuck steak
1/2 c flour
salt and pepper
oil
1 can tomatoes
1 onion, sliced

Directions:
Directions:
Mix 1/2 cup flour with salt and pepper (to taste). Pound into steak.
Brown steak in small amount of oil in an oven safe hot skillet (dutch oven works well) turning to brown on all sides.
Add tomatoes and onion. Cover. Cook for 1 1/2 hours at 350º
